Heavy rainfall is not the only root cause of flooding. Internal issues like burst pipelines and also overflows can result in emergency flooding. This will certainly likewise create damages to your building. Failing to address the problem will intensify the damage as well as boost the possibilities of mold development. Keep reading to discover what you can when managing emergency flooding.

1. Turn Off Main Water Shutoff

Pipes can burst due to cold temperatures, high stress, obstruction, water heating unit concerns, and other elements. No matter the reason, you need to act swiftly to ensure permeable home materials, appliances, and furnishings do not absorb the water, resulting in damage.

2. Shut down the Breaker

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Keep the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Necessary Damp Times

When it pertains to saving your home furnishings and also home appliances, time is important. Hence, you should relocate whatever sharpen personal belongings you can from the damaged area to a dry area. This deters additional damages because the longer they soak in water, the much more comprehensive the problem.

4. Document the Extent of Damage

Bear in mind of all the damages brought upon by the burst pipe. You can document notes, take pictures, and also collect video clips. This is a terrific means to offer evidence to gather insurance claims on your house insurance policy coverage. With paperwork, you can also get a clear picture of the level of the damage.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You must get rid of excess water as soon as possible. Should there be a huge quantity of standing water, you may require a water pump for removal. You can rent this tools if you do not have one. If it's late during the night, the convention pail approach likewise works. Usage numerous containers and also manual labor to take it out. When marginal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old t shirts or towels. You may likewise require to eliminate broken materials like rugs and also carpets.

6. Dry the Location

You can additionally establish up electrical followers and put them in the best setting. A dehumidifier likewise functions in taking out moisture to stop mold as well as mold and mildews.

7. Work with Professionals

When you experience considerable water damage because of emergency situation fl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can collaborate with a reconstruction specialist to rebuild and also remodel your home. Most importantly, don't neglect to call a reputable plumbing technician to repair the burst pipe and check the rest of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will certainly be rendered ineffective.

Surviving the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one location, you need to be used by now on what to do, where to go and also what to need to be prepared for bad climate. If you're not used to getting pummeled by high winds and difficult rainfall, you most likely don't have an suggestion exactly how ideal to deal with a storm situation.

For starters, tornados do not simply come without a warning. Weather stations keep an eye on the environment day in and day out. If a storm is feasible, they will certainly release two types of cautions: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a feasible tornado in your area. You most likely will be experiencing a dark, gloomy sky, an uncommonly windy day as well as some rain. The tornado might or might not come, yet this is the moment to keep tuned to your regional radio for news and also upd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a storm is headed towards your area. Try to remain inside as much as feasible. Or if residents are encouraged to leave to a much safer place, go as early as you can. Don't wait up until the last minute to leave your house. By that time, the streets could be flooded as well as web traffic misbehaves. You do not intend to be caught in your car in bad weather condition.

Snowstorm-- normally happens in winter season and implies hefty snow, strong winds and wind chill. When a caution is released, stay clear of taking a trip as high as possible and also stay inside. There is no usage subjecting on your own outdoors where you might obtain caught in web traffic or in locations where you will be challenging to reach or even worse, discover.

For all our modern technology, nobody can stop a tornado from coming. The only way to survive it is to be prepared to deal with the emergency situation. Points do not always spoil during storms, yet weather is unforeseeable and anything can take place. To help you plan for a tornado emergency situation, below are a couple of ideas:

Spruce up.
Use enough clothing to keep yourself warm. Warmth may not be readily available in your house so obtain additional layers and blankets to maintain your body temperature completely.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ks and also boots prepared as well.

Have food all set.
Emergency provisions are a have to during tornado emergencies. Make certain you supply on no-cook food, canned food, some candy as well as various other non-perishable items. And don't fail to remember can openers, scissors or tools. If the tornado obtains regrettable and also the streets are swamped, you will have a problem going out to the grocery store shops. Besides, shops may be closed.

Keep containers of water useful. Tidy water may be tough to come by throughout really poor conditions as well as the most awful thing you can do is deal with d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for each individual per day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ill up the bathtub.
You'll require more water for washing as well as purging the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ump will not run, so best load your bath t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have little kids in your home,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and also maintaining children away from the bathroom unless required.

Emergency situation set
Have a medical or very first kit prepared and see to it it's freshly-stocked. It should include disinfectants,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also needed medicines. It's additionally a good suggestion to have one more kit in your vehicle.

If anyone in your family is under special drug, make certain you have enough materials to last till after the storm is over and medication shops are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power failures during tornado emergencies. You will not have any power, so stock on candle lights, flashlights and emergency situation lights. Have added fresh batteries and matches in case you run out.

If you can not activ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your area. Media will keep track of the storm as well as will certainly maintain you upgraded.

You could need warm water during the duration when power is not yet available, so keep a little storage tank of gas around simply in case. Your outside gas grill will do perfectly.

Obtain an alternating shelter.
If you assume your home will experience considerably, it's a excellent idea to take into consideration an alternative shelter. It could be an evacuation center or an additional residence or building that is more secure. Make certain you have enough gas in your storage tank in case you require to get out of your house as well as action some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have far better chances of being risk-free and also dry.
